Please note: this class runs from 8:00 am to 4:00 pm on two consecutive days (10/27 and 10/28)
  • Do you fully understand the risks to your facility?
  • Do you know what makes your facility susceptible to risk?
  • Are you prepared to mitigate those risks?

The Critical Asset Risk Management course helps participants answer those questions by teaching critical components of risk management. Through a combination of lecture, facilitated discussion, and group activities, participants will learn how threats, vulnerabilities, and consequences determine risk, and are given an opportunity to practice the fundamentals of conducting vulnerability assessments by conducting on-site assessments of select local facilities.  Additionally they will identify potential mitigation measures associated with their findings and work together to develop and present a risk assessment report.

Topics

  • Overview of Risk Management Process
  • Threat and Hazard Identification
  • Asset Valuation
  • Vulnerabilities
  • Risk Assessment
  • Mitigation Mission Area
  • On-Site Risk Assessment
